原创 ElasticSearch 快速入門
elasticsearch 是什麼? Elasticsearch是一個高度可擴展的開源全文搜索和分析引擎。它允許你快速、近實時地存儲、搜索和分析大量數據。它通常被用作底層引擎/技術,爲具有複雜搜索功能和要求的應用提供動力 應用場景
原创 hadoop2.7.3 集羣安裝
hadoop2.7.3 完全分佈式集羣搭建及任務測試 第一步 準備工作 準備3臺服務器或者虛擬機,爲了學習並節省成本,可以使用VirtualBox或者wmware 來創建虛擬機 本人使用的是VirtualBox,系統是ubuntu
原创 maven的安裝
第一步 在瀏覽器中的地址欄中輸入 http://maven.apache.org/ 在左側的的菜單欄中點擊DownLoad 第二步 明確自己安裝的JDK版本和自己的電腦系統,然後選擇適合自己的版本(沒有安裝JDK的先去安裝JDK
原创 nexus 的安裝
第一步 確認自己的JDK版本(7以上),然後去 http://nexus.sonatype.org/downloads/ 下載 nexus-2.14.3-02-bundle.tar.gz 或者 nexus-2.14.3-02-bun
原创 maven的settings.xml配置詳情
<?xml version="1.0" encoding="UTF-8"?> <!-- Licensed to the Apache Software Foundation (ASF) under one
原创 pom.xml中jetty插件的配置詳情
<plugin> <groupId>org.eclipse.jetty</groupId> <artifactId>jetty-maven-plugin</artifactId> <version>9.3.14
原创 maven pom.xml的配置
<project xmlns="http://maven.apache.org/POM/4.0.0" x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ance" xsi:schemaLo
原创 ElasticSearch-Analysis-IK
ElasticSearch-Analysis-IK 1下載源碼 在此之前,本機需要安裝了jdk8. ik分詞源碼下載 地址:https://github.com/medcl/elasticsearch-analysis-ik 根據自己
原创 IDEA maven 下載依賴jar包失敗的解決思路
情況一:下載nexus私服(或鏡像)下的jar ,如果發佈到nexus服務的jar時,IDEA無法下載下來, 首先 確定自己的電腦能訪問私服(或鏡像) 其次 確定私服(或鏡像)下已經有相應的依賴jar 最後 清理項目IDEA的緩存 刪
原创 redis 的學習路線
1 快速學習redis教程 http://www.yiibai.com/redis/redis_environment.html 2 redis的詳情配置 http://www.cnblogs.com/kreo/p/442336
原创 ELK的啓動
學習ELK(Elasticsearch Logstash Kibana )這三個框架需要到官網https://www.elastic.co/downloads下載自己喜歡的版本(version)。 Elasticsearch 1
原创 海量數據插入數據庫的快速方案
在我們開發項目過程中,一般都會遇到大批量的數據導入。比如根據訂購日誌來生成訂購記錄。經過查詢資料發現了2種比較快速的方法: 方法一 需要對日誌文件做解析出來的。 public class JDBCMoreQuick {p
原创 Redis的學習
Redis的介紹: 1. Redis是Remote Dictornary Server的縮寫,是一個key value存儲系統. 2. Redis提供了豐富的數據結構,包括Strings,Lists,Hashes,Sets和Order
原创 JVM的運行原理及優化配置
JVM的運行原理及優化配置 運行原理: 當一個URL被訪問時,內存申請過程如下: 1. JVM會試圖爲相關Java對象在Eden中初始化一塊內存區域 2. 當Eden空間足夠時,內存申請結束。否則到下一步 3. JVM試圖釋放在E
原创 多線程編程
Java 線程的創建方法2種 一種繼承 Thread 另一種 實現接口Runnable 都要重寫run方法。 線程不安全: private Object obj; Synchronized(obj) Obj有多少個,鎖就有多少